The Roland U.S. website has an interesting tidbit telling of an "amazing new instrument" that will be showcased at Musikmesse on 4.6.2011 according to the marquee. What is it?? Several people have speculated it will be a new keyboard or synth. Some think it could be a reformulated Jupiter 8 synth. The reason they say that is before this latest image on the Roland U.S. website there was a previous image depicting a keyboard with a guy carrying it under one arm and with words to the effect of "a Legend re-emerges". One of Roland's "legend" products was the highly acclaimed Jupiter 8 analog synth released back in the 80's. But could it perhaps be a new Roland totl arranger?? Roland's "legend" arranger was probably considered the G1000 and/or possibly the G70. It is anyone's guess but I personally kinda doubt it will be an arranger. Since Musikmesse is fast approaching it won't be long before we'll all know what this mystery product is. Whatever it is, hopefully the hype i.e. of "a Legend re-emerges" will stand up to scrutiny upon release. Roland is kind of noted for causing a big stir over relatively "meh" products e.g. remember the little 'Mini Red Amp' debacle? Roland put up this countdown marquee a few years ago touting a dubiously dinky little red guitar amp that looked like it was only 6" high with a maximum output of around 15 watts or some other ridiculously low figure. Hopefully this new "amazing instrument" that Roland is touting won't be something similar and thus a cause for ridicule. Time will tell. wink I'll try to stay positive in the meantime. cool
